This Universal Scholarship application is for graduating students in Harrison County, IN.

FAFSA is not mandatory for the Universal Scholarship Application. ONLY students who want to be considered for financial need-based scholarships will be need to complete FAFSA. Students who are unable to complete FAFSA can use enrollment in either the 21st Century Scholarship Program or the Free/Reduced Meal program as a metric for eligibility.

This scholarship is open to Harrison County residents who will have graduated by the end of June of the award year with a diploma from a regionally accredited Indiana high school and who have been accepted to pursue a full-time baccalaureate course study at an accredited public or private college or university in Indiana.

This program will provide one scholarship for full tuition, required fees, and a special allocation of up to $900.00 per year for required books and required equipment for four years of undergraduate study on a full-time basis, leading to a baccalaureate degree at any INDIANA public or private college or university accredited by the Higher Learning Commission of the North Central Association of Colleges and Schools.

The HCCF Adult Scholarship Program was developed to increase the number of adults, within the county, who have a higher education degree.*

Applicants will need to demonstrate legal residency in Harrison County, IN for the past 24 months.
        Documentation such as tax forms, housing receipts, or utility bills can be used to verify residency.
Applicants will be requested to upload a copy of transcripts from colleges previously attended. These do not have to be official, or sealed originals. Copies will be sufficient. If no transcripts are available, please let HCCF know.
Applicants must be 25 years old or older to apply.

*Students who have previously obtained an Associates or Bachelor's degree are not eligible to apply.

Scholarship provides support for students studying in a trade or vocational program.
Students must be between the ages of 18-21 years old and be legal residents of Harrison County.
Funding may be used for tuition, books, course related fees and required tools, uniforms or supplies.
